Gunmen ransack home, steal cars from family

They tied up the family including two small children.

GUN-toting robbers held-up a family of five, including two young children, at their Dan Pienaar Drive, Toti home on Tuesday evening, 19 January.

The incident happened at about 9pm, as the home owner was busy with laundry.

“The back door was open and I sat down in the living room with my four-year-old son. Two men walked in, one armed with a gun and the other with a knife,” said the traumatised home owner.

They picked up her phone and asked if there was anyone else in the house. “I told them my husband was in the bathroom. They took my son and I to the bathroom and told us to lie down. My daughter (6) who was asleep and my mother-in-law who was in the flat were also brought down and forced to lie on the floor.”

By now five men were in the house, of whom two were armed with guns.

“It happened so quickly, you can’t fight or talk back.”

“Our hands and feet were tied and my husband’s hands were bound with a toy handcuff which locks. The robbers asked for TVs, laptops and gold jewellery.”
The robbers helped themselves to four cellphones, two flat screen TVs, a laptop, wallets, jewellery, a DVD player with surround sound and meat from the freezer.

They also drove off in the owners vehicles, a bakkie and a car. “They had trouble starting my car, came back and took my husband to help them.”
After they left, the owners managed to untie each other and ran outside to get help from a neighbour, who cut off the handcuffs.

The robbers entered the property by jumping over the boundary wall of the house next door, which is empty.
Patrolling police noticed the commotion and gave chase. The robbers abandoned the car, which they bumped, but the bakkie has not been recovered as yet.

In a second, unrelated incident, two vehicles were stolen from a secure complex in Adelaide Road in Doonside in the early hours of Wednesday, 20 January.
Thieves entered through a bathroom window, took two sets of keys and drove out of the gated complex.
